Upia Population - Papumpare, Arunachal Pradesh
Upia is a medium size village located in Doimukh Circle of Papumpare district, Arunachal Pradesh with total 161 families residing. The Upia village has population of 960 of which 579 are males while 381 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Upia village population of children with age 0-6 is 133 which makes up 13.85 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Upia village is 658 which is lower than Arunachal Pradesh state average of 938. Child Sex Ratio for the Upia as per census is 956, lower than Arunachal Pradesh average of 972.
Upia village has higher literacy rate compared to Arunach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Upia village was 79.44 % compared to 65.38 % of Arunachal Pradesh. In Upia Male literacy stands at 88.65 % while female literacy rate was 64.56 %.

Upia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 161 | - | - |
Population | 960 | 579 | 381 |
Child (0-6) | 133 | 68 | 65 |
Schedule Caste |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Schedule Tribe | 618 | 299 | 319 |
Literacy | 79.44 % | 88.65 % | 64.56 % |
Total Workers | 392 | 315 | 77 |
Main Worker | 367 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 25 | 14 | 11 |
